With a population of over 36,000 and expected to grow by nearly 40% by 2031, Truganina is a rapidly expanding suburb west of Melbourne's city center. However, this rapid expansion has come at a cost - the area is largely characterized by low-density development, meaning residents are heavily reliant on automobiles with limited public transit options. Bureaucracy is a persistent headache, as new housing developments often outpace the rollout of infrastructure and services.

While Truganina offers affordable housing and proximity to major employment hubs, the suburb's car-centric nature and growing pains make it best suited for those willing to navigate the challenges of an area in flux. Those seeking a more established, walkable community may want to look elsewhere.
